2 Legionella in Cooling Towers Background Various studies have shown that 40-60% of all cooling towers harbor Legionella bacteria. Cooling towers are the largest and most common source of Legionnaire s disease outbreaks because of their risk for widespread circulation. Although 90% of Legionella infections in humans are caused by Legionella pneumophila, there are 45 named species of Legionella of which 19 species have been documented as human pathogens. A multinational study of community-acquired legionnaires disease identified 508 cultureconfirmed cases [Yu VL, Plouffe JF, Pastoris MC, et al., 2002]. L. pneumophila was responsible for the greatest percentage of cases (91.5%), followed by Legionella longbeachae (3.9%) and L. bozemanii (2.4%). The remainder of cases were due to L. micdadei, L. feeleii, L. dumoffii, Legionella wadsworthii, and L. anisa. Legionella in Cooling Towers Cooling towers, because of their mode of operation, can create ideal conditions for microbial growth and they also deliberately require the creation of sprays and aerosols, which can be dispersed over a wide area if not controlled properly. Cooling towers operate at temperatures that can provide an environment for the growth of microorganisms in water (20-45 C), including Legionella. Other operating conditions contributing to the growth of Legionella in cooling towers include: High microbial concentration, including algae, amoebae, slime and other bacteria. Presence of biofilm, scale, sediment, sludge, rust and other organic matter. Presence of degraded plumbing materials that may provide nutrients to enhance bacterial growth. Cooling towers must be properly disinfected and maintained to reduce the risk of Legionella. Controlling Legionella Historically biocides such as chlorine, chlorine dioxide, hypobromite, and ozone have been used for Legionella control in cooling towers. In the natural environment, Legionella lives in three forms: as a free swimming form, in a biofouling and as an amoebic parasite (lives within amoebae). Studies demonstrated that L. pneumophila can use free-living amoebae as host cells for intracellular replication [Skinner et. al., 1983; Newsome et. al., 1985; Fields, 1993]. Legionella and free-living amoebae may be present simultaneously in aquatic environments, hot systems and cooling towers, thus, freeliving amoebae may play a role in the amplification and protection of Legionella and could act as a vector in the transmission of Legionnaires disease [Declerck et. al., 2007]). Amoebae can represent a shield for Legionella against disinfection treatment (e. g. chemicals biocides). Previous data shows that amoebae have resistance to a variety of biocides (additional information in page 9) and therefore protect the Legionella. 2

3 Legionella in Cooling Towers Continued When disinfection by biocides is insufficiently applied, the survival of Legionella and amoebae can promote a rapid growth and therefore can be a source of Legionnaires' disease outbreak [Bargellini et. al., 2011; Thomas et. al., 2004]. The most common source of Legionnaires' disease outbreaks are cooling towers, primarily because of the risk for widespread circulation [Garcia-Fulgueiras et. al., 2003]. UV light has a strong germicidal effect that kills microorganisms by penetrating their cell membranes and damaging their DNA so they are unable to reproduce and die out. Compared with other Gramnegative bacteria, the legionellae are highly susceptible to UV irradiation [Antopol & Ellner, 1979]. 4 Determining UV Dose to Inactivate Amoebae Entamoeba histolytica Background Entamoeba histolytica is a protozoan parasite responsible for a disease called amoebiasis. 50 million people are infected worldwide, mostly in tropical countries in areas of poor sanitation. The highest prevalence of amebiasis is in developing countries where barriers between human feces and food and water supplies are inadequate. E. histolytica is transmitted via ingestion of the cystic form of the protozoa. Inside humans E. histolytica lives and multiplies as a trophozoite. In the current study E. histolytica was served as a Legionella host model. Atlantium Technologies studied the effects of UV light produced by Low-Pressure (LP) lamps and the proprietary Atlantium Medium-Pressure (ATL- MP) lamps on the viability of E. histolytica. Thesis There are several studies demonstrating that certain microorganisms such as Adeno virus, are more susceptible to broad spectrum UV light produced by MP lamps, compared to monochromatic UV light produced by LP lamps. The thesis behind this proposal is to evaluate whether E. histolytica may need a lower UV dose using the proprietary ATL-MP lamp. Figure 1: Cultured E. histolytica trophozoite*. *( oeba%20histolytica) Objective Evaluate the reduction equivalent UV doses (RED) required for inactivation of E. histolytica by using a standard bio-dosimetry procedure in a static monochromatic and polychromatic UV set up. Experimental Design The E. histolytica UV dose-response was measured using a standard LP and the ATL-MP collimated beam apparatus devices. UV dose calculation for LP CBA was performed according to the USEPA recommendations [USEPA, 2006]. While the UV dose delivered (UV fluence) by the MP CBA was calculated according to A. Lakretz et al 2010 [Lakretz et.al., 2010] with slight modifications. Exponentially grown trophozoites (7x10 5 ) were washed two times with PBS. One-half of the population was kept in PBS without being exposed to UV and the second half was exposed to UV at various intensities and time settings. The viability of the trophozoites exposed or not to UV was first determined by exclusion of the vital stain Eosin (0.2%). The exposed and non-exposed trophozoites were then transferred to TYI-S-33 medium and they were cultivated for 24 h at 37 o C. After this period of culture, the cells were counted and the number of trophozoites in the non-uvexposed inoculum was used as 100%. 4

5 Results and Conclusions The experimental results were graphically processed as UV doses vs. Vitality percentage (Table 2; Figures 2-3). Immediate counting: only 22% viability was observed after illumination with LP lamp at UV dose of 90 mj/cm 2, while 100% mortality was observed after illumination with ATL-MP lamp at 26.3 mj/cm 2. After 24 h of culture: no total kill (2% viability) was observed after illumination with LP lamp at UV dose of 90 mj/cm 2, while 100% mortality was observed after illumination with ATL-MP lamp at 8.8 mj/cm 2. The ATL-MP lamp is more effective in inactivation of E. histolytica compared to the LP lamp. The enclosed LP results are in agreement with previous results of resistivity of amoebae to LP lamp [Maya et. al., 2003; Cervero-Arago et. al., 2014]. *Acknowledgment: this study was conducted in collaboration with Prof. Ankri Serge; Technion Israel institute of technology; Faculty of Medicine. COMPARATIVE ASSESSMENT OF CHLORINE, HEAT, OZONE, AND UV LIGHT FOR KILLING LEGIONELLA PNEUMOPHILA WITHIN A MODEL PLUMBING SYSTEM PAUL MURACA, JANET E. STOUT, & VICTOR L. YU, APPLIED AND ENVIRONMENTAL MICROBIOLOGY, (1987) - Study showed UV light to inactivate L. pneumophila rapidly and with minimal required maintenance. - Study showed UV light produced a 5-log inactivation of L. pneumophila in less than 1 hour. EFFICACY OF ULTRAVIOLET LIGHT IN PREVENTING LEGIONELLA COLONIZATION OF A HOSPITAL WATER DISTRIBUTION SYSTEM ZEMING LIU, JANET E. STOUT, LAWRENCE TEDESCO, MARCIE BOLDIN, CHARLES HWANG & VICTOR L. YU, Wat. Res (1995) - Study showed UV treatment installed near point-of-use can prevent Legionella recolonization for at least 4 months. PHOTOREACTIVATION OF UV-IRRADIATED LEGIONELLA PNEUMOPHILA AND OTHER LEGIONELLA SPECIES GREGORY B. KNUDSON, APPLIED AND ENVIRONMENTAL MICROBIOLOGY (1985) - Study showed seven Legionella species are very sensitive to low doses of UV. SUSCEPTIBILITY OF LEGIONELLA PNEUMOPHILA TO ULTRAVIOLET RADIATION STEPHEN C. ANTOPOL & PAUL D. ELLNER (1979) - Study showed Legionella pneumophila were found to be sensitive to low doses of UV. STIMULATORY EFFECT OF COOLING TOWER BIOCIDES ON AMOEBAE SUJATA SRIKANTH & SHARON G. BERK, APPLIED AND ENVIRONMENTAL MICROBIOLOGY (1993) - Results from this study suggest cooling tower amoebae may adapt to biocides. - Biocides used to control microbial growth may actually enhance populations of host organisms for pathogenic bacteria. - The cooling towers amoebae not only were not affected by concentrations of biocides that inhibited non cooling towers amoebae but also reproduced faster in the presence of low concentrations of biocides - Cooling tower amoebae survived the manufacturer's recommended doses of the biocides. ADAPTION OF AMOEBA TO COOLING TOWER BIOCIDES SUJATA SRIKANTH & GREENWOOD GENETIC, MICROB ECOL (1994) Results from this study show amoebae can adapt to biocides in a short time. Cross-resistance was also observed; exposure to one biocide caused resistance to other biocides. SURVIVAL OF PROTOZOA IN COOLING TOWER BIOCIDES EE SUTHERLAND & SG BERK, JOURNAL OF INDUSTRIAL MICROBIOLOGY (1996) - Results from this study show that cooling towers amoebae may survive the recommended concentration of certain biocides, and this information may be important in devising procedures for eradicating hosts for legionellae. - It appears that L. pneumophila within protozoa may not be killed by the biocides.
